Bill Summary

A BILL To amend title 10, United States Code, to provide for the expansion of the Junior Reserve Officers Training Corps, to expand the Cyber Institutes Program, and for other purposes. 1

AI Summary

This bill, the JROTC and ROTC Enhancement Act of 2020, aims to expand the Junior Reserve Officers Training Corps (JROTC) program and the Cyber Institutes Program. The bill amends the existing law to include an introduction to military, national, and public service in the JROTC curriculum, and requires the Secretary of Defense to develop a plan to establish and support at least 6,000 JROTC units by 2031. Additionally, the bill directs the Secretary of Defense to submit a report on the effectiveness and expansion opportunities of the Cyber Institutes Program, and makes funds available for the program's expansion after September 2021.
